Member Eligibility

  • Boys and Girls from birth to their 18th birthday.
  •  Individual must be a blood descendant, lineal or collateral, of men and women who served honorable in the Confederate Army, Navy, Civil Service or gave material aid to the Cause.
  •  Or individual is a lineal or collateral descendants of members of the UDC whose papers are acceptable by the present requirements for membership.
